Ingredients You Need
- Ground Beef: Provides the main protein base and rich flavor.
- Ground Pork: Adds moisture and enhances the overall taste.
- Breadcrumbs: Binds the ingredients and helps retain moisture.
- Egg: Acts as a binder, holding the meatballs together.
- Garlic: Infuses the meatballs with a savory and aromatic flavor.
- Onion: Adds sweetness and depth of flavor.
- Italian Seasoning: Provides a classic Italian taste.
- Salt and Pepper: Enhances the overall flavor profile.
How to Make Air Fryer Meatballs Step by Step
- In a large bowl, combine ground beef, ground pork, breadcrumbs, egg, minced garlic, chopped onion,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
- Use your hands to thoroughly mix all ingredients until well combined. Be careful not to overmix.
- Roll the mixture into 1-inch meatballs. You should get approximately 24 meatballs.
-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C) for 3 minutes. This helps ensure even cooking.
- Place the meatballs in the air fryer basket in a single layer. Avoid overcrowding the basket. You may need to cook in batches.
Pro Tip: Lightly spray the air fryer basket with cooking oil to prevent sticking and promote browning.
- Air fry for 12-15 minutes, flipping halfway through, until the meatballs are cooked through and golden brown.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C).
- Remove the air fryer meatballs from the air fryer and serve immediately.
Expert Tips for Best Results
- Do not overcrowd the air fryer basket; cook in batches for even cooking.
- Use a meat thermometer to ensure the meatballs re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C).
- For extra flavor, add grated Parmesan cheese to the meat mixture.
- If the meatballs are browning too quickly, lower the air fryer temperature slightly.
- Serve immediately after cooking for the best texture and flavor.
- Store leftover meatballs in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Variations and Substitutions
- Gluten-Free: Use gluten-free breadcrumbs as a substitute.
- Dairy-Free: Omit the Parmesan cheese or use a dairy-free alternative.
- Spicy: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the meat mixture.
- Italian Sausage: Substitute ground pork with Italian sausage for a different flavor profile.
How to Serve and Store
Serve these air fryer meatballs with your favorite pasta and marinara sauce. They are also great as appetizers with a dipping sauce, such as BBQ sauce or ranch dressing. You can also serve them in sandwiches or sliders.
Store leftover meatballs in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
You can freeze cooked meatballs for up to 2 months. Place them in a freezer-safe bag or container.
Reheat meatballs in the air fryer at 350°F (175°C) for 5-7 minutes, or until heated through. You can also reheat them in the microwave or on the stovetop.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use frozen meatballs in the air fryer?
Yes, you can cook frozen meatballs in the air fryer. Add a few minutes to the cooking time.
How do I prevent the meatballs from sticking to the basket?
Spraying the air fryer basket with cooking oil helps prevent sticking. You can also use parchment paper specifically designed for air fryers.
What is the best temperature to cook meatballs in the air fryer?
400°F (200°C) is generally the best temperature. It ensures even cooking and browning.
Can I make these meatballs 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the meat mixture ahead of time. Store it in the refrigerator until ready to roll and cook.
How long do meatballs last in the refrigerator?
Cooked meatballs last for up to 3 days in the refrigerator. Store them in an airtight container.
Are air fryer meatballs healthier than fried meatballs?
Yes, air fryer meatballs are healthier. They require significantly less oil than traditional frying.
